the xh-a1 is a great camera but do you need hi def? it has better light gathering capabilities than the GL2, and is in another leauge for film quality!

We use sony pd 170 to film our outdoor tv show, It has the best low light capabilities 1 lux where the canon is either a 3-4 lux. lux being the amount of light needed to film basicly. It also has more pro features to it like 2 built in xlr inputs for wireless mics. take alook at the sony Hi def if that is what you want the FX1 is a great camera too!
